Career Path

The **Professional Certificate in Space Resource AI Sustainability** is an exciting and emerging field, offering numerous job opportunities for professionals with the right skill set. In the United Kingdom, the demand for experts in this industry is growing, with competitive salary ranges and rewarding career paths. Here are some of the key roles and their respective market trends in the field of Space Resource AI Sustainability: 1. **AI Engineer**: AI engineers are essential to the development of intelligent systems for space resource management and sustainability. They design, implement, and maintain AI models, algorithms, and applications for various space-related projects. 2. **Space Systems Engineer**: Space systems engineers are responsible for designing, integrating, and testing spacecraft, launch vehicles, and ground systems for space missions. As AI and sustainability become increasingly important in space exploration, these professionals play a critical role in ensuring the success of space resource management projects. 3. **Data Scientist**: Data scientists collect, process, and analyse large datasets to extract valuable insights and create data-driven solutions for space resource management and sustainability challenges. They use machine learning techniques, statistical models, and data visualisation tools to analyse complex datasets from space missions and ground-based observations. 4. **Robotics Engineer**: Robotics engineers design, build, and maintain robotic systems for space applications, such as rovers, drones, and other autonomous vehicles. They ensure that these robotic systems can operate effectively in challenging space environments while adhering to sustainability principles. 5. **Sustainability Analyst**: Sustainability analysts evaluate the environmental, social, and economic impacts of space projects and propose strategies to minimise negative consequences. They help space organisations adopt sustainable practices and contribute to a greener space industry. 6. **GIS Specialist**: GIS (Geographic Information System) specialists work with geospatial data and technologies to support space resource management and sustainability. They create maps, analyse spatial data, and develop GIS applications for space missions and ground-based operations. 7. **Project Manager**: Project managers oversee space resource AI sustainability projects, ensuring that they are completed on time, within budget, and to the required quality standards. They coordinate with various stakeholders, manage resources, and mitigate project risks.
